Default Egr removal

Picked up a lumpy idle last week.Changed all coil packs as a precaution due to age and milage .Made no difference.I then got a maf eml light came on reset came on again the following day.Replaced maf sensor you guessed it no change.I then had another eml, p0400 come on in the way of a sticking egr valve or blocked pipe.This could also explain why I get a exhaust fume smell in the car when cold.
So today I've stripped off what I could to get to the egr valve.Once I found the little ******* I am know stuck on how to get it out to clean it.I undid two 10mm headed bolts but this only loosened the top halve of the valve.How to I get to the mounting bolts unless I'm going blind I can't see them. Do I have to remove the supercharger and bring it out all together.
I've had a search around the internet on the usual forums but still none the wiser.
Any information or ideas would be greatly received.
